Threedrones Posted February 27, 2022 #1 Share Posted February 27, 2022 We were on FOS 2/21-2/25. Enjoyed getting back to cruising. Rather than a review, I’ll just give a brief synopsis. Covid pre-test was a breeze. We made an appointment at CVS and the process took less than 10 minutes for both my wife and me. Results were received in about an hour. We had a 12:30 boarding time. We arrived at 12:10 and were in the Windjammer before our assigned boarding time. Entire process took 15 minutes. We were concerned about the mask issue, but it really was not a bother. With few exceptions, it seemed like a normal cruise. I know that RCL has loosened their protocols already since our cruise, but even if they hadn’t we would be very comfortable cruising again during Covid. 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Threedrones Posted February 27, 2022 Author #3 Share Posted February 27, 2022 Our sailing was at 60% capacity. Dinner in Main Dining was by reservation, though we saw people come down and get a reservation for an hour later. Don’t know about breakfast in main dining room because we mostly had room service. Currently, Continental and American breakfast is free through room service. It arrives on time and hot. Windjammer was available for all meals, including dinner, without reservations. It was only closed for lunch when we were at Coco Cay.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
